AMERICAN BOY, THEAuthor: Taylor, AndrewCatalogue number: 6707 Number of cassettes: 16 Time (hours): 0.00 Main subject: Detective & Mystery Stories Set in England in 1819, Thomas Shield is a master at a school near London attended by a young American boy and his friend, Charles Frant. Thomas, drawn to Frant's beautiful mother, is caught up in her family's deadly tangle of sex, money, murder and lies. At the heart of all this is the American boy, but what is the secret about him? |

LAMBS OF LONDON, THEAuthor: Ackroyd, PeterCatalogue number: 7182 Number of cassettes: 6 Time (hours): 0.00 Main subject: Historical Fiction - Pre 1914 With an ailing father and distrusful mother Mary Lamb has a restricted life, but takes solace from her brother Charles' life. Mary falls in love with William Ireland, a bookseller, from whom Charles buys a book. They later realise that this is no ordinary book and William Ireland is no ordinary young man. |

LINE OF BEAUTY, THEAuthor: Hollinghurst, AlanCatalogue number: 7185 Number of cassettes: 14 Time (hours): 0.00 Main subject: Contemporary Fiction Set in the 1980s, Nick Guest lodges with the Fedden family in London. Gerald Fedden has just entered Parliament and is hotly tipped as ministerial material. Nick witnesses the full impact of 1980s hedonism; the money, the drugs, and sex. Then the advent of AIDS and the party stops. |
